Fans arriving at the New Orleans Superdome early for the Saints exhilarating win over the Vikings Saturday (1/23) got an extra thrill when lifelong Saints fan Jimmy Buffett joined a local band on a flatbed near one of the parking lots for a couple of songs. Buffett, arriving for the game with the producer of the New Orleans Jazz & Heritage Festival, spotted someone wearing one of those wacky visors with a wig implanted in it, a favorite with Saints fans because anyone wearing one resembles coach Sean Payton. Jimmy, scheduled to rendevous with Payton after the game for a celebration if the Saints won, decided he had to have one. The owner offered to give it up if Buffett sang a song with the Creole String Beans. He obliged, jumping onto the flatbed and doing two - Sea Cruise and Margaritaville. See it here.
